    Default Cat throwing up blood

    My cat has a hairball problem, and throws up a lot. Today she threw up, and there was blood in it. The local vets are not open on Sunday, so I cannot bring her in for a check-up. Does anyone know what may be wrong with her?

    Default Re: Cat throwing up blood

    Well, the hairball may have grazed his esophagus a bit and cause a little bit of bleeding - like when sometimes we blow our noses too hard a bust a small capillary, which heals almost immediately. I suggest you observe your cat for the next couple of hours. If he is not in distress (pain, vomiting, no appetite, depressed, meowing, etc.) then, the spot of blood may have been from a small abrasion caused by the expellation of the hairball.

    However, you should still take her to the vet as soon as possible; she may have eaten something sharp. If it gets serious, I do believe there are emergency vets you could call.
